SASMOS Signs MoU with HAL & NAeL To Explore Cooperation in Fibre Optics, Electronics and Electrical Interconnect Systems in the Aerospace Domain

SASMOS HET Technologies Limited, a Bangalore-based manufacturer and developer of Electrical, Electromechanical and  Electronics integrated solutions, has sign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) with Indian state-owned aerospace and defence company Hindustan Aeronautics Limited (HAL) and its wholly-owned subsidiary Naini Aerospace Limited (NAel), to work together in  the field of advanced electronics, electrical and Fibre optics interconnections in the aerospace domain.

The MoU was signed on 11th March ‘22 byKrishna, GM- HAL,Amit Mai Shrivastava , CEO NAeL andS. Sethuraman, Director Sasmos in the presence of R Madhavan, CMD, Sajal Prakash, CEO HAL, H G Chandrashekar, Founder and MD SASMOSand other dignified professionals includingN V Maslekar, Director, Sasmos.

Talking about the collaboration, H G Chandrashekar, Chairman & Managing Director, SASMOS HET Technologies Limited said, “The agreements entered into today attest to SASMOS’ commitment towards designing, manufacturing, and integrating ingenious solutions for Indian Aerospace domain, Made in India.  HAL is undoubtedly one of India’s largest aerospace-defence companies in India and a collaboration with them is prestigious yet filled with lots of excitement, ambition and responsibility.” He further adds, “Through this agreement, Sasmos alongwith NAeL intend to explore the potential for advanced network connectivity solutions to enhance the performance and develop solutions for HAL in the aerospace domain. We believe this is a great leap towards strengthening and growing our propositions for ‘Atma Nirbhar Bharat’.”

Sajal Prakash, CEO, HAL expressed his delight to work with SASMOS and showed confidence considering the proven track record and achievements of SASMOS in the aerospace and Defence sector in India and globally.

The MoU is intended to explore business co-operation, especially in the northern India, through utilization of capacity and capabilities of NAeL to bring their complementary skills and competencies, experience and expertise in fibre optics, electronics and electrical interconnected system in the Aerospace domain through the support from HAL and SASMOS.
